Raw Onions (Sliced)

Raw Onions (Sliced) is a bulb vegetable widely used in cuisines around the world for its sharp, aromatic flavor; varieties include yellow, sweet and red onions and it’s a staple in sautés, soups, salads and pickles. Nutritionally it’s very low in fat and calories while contributing small amounts of fiber and micronutrients, notably 7.75mg of vitamin C per 100g. Onions also contain sulfur-containing compounds and flavonoids that contribute to their pungent aroma and have been linked to supportive effects on heart health and gut bacteria when eaten regularly.
